AccueilAccueil  FAQFAQ  RechercherRechercher  Dernières imagesDernières images  S'enregistrerS'enregistrer  Connexion  
-40%
Le deal à ne pas rater :
-40% sur le Pack Gaming Mario PDP Manette filaire + Casque filaire ...
29.99 € 49.99 €
Voir le deal
Le deal à ne pas rater :
Pokémon EV06 : où acheter le Bundle Lot 6 Boosters Mascarade ...
Voir le deal

 

 Variable en string.. :-)

Aller en bas 
2 participants
AuteurMessage
Oane
Utilisateur moyen
Oane


Messages : 60
Localisation : Paris

Variable en string.. :-) Empty
MessageSujet: Variable en string.. :-)   Variable en string.. :-) EmptyVen 15 Juin 2007 - 9:25

Salut!
Voila j'aimerais créer un script qui permet la creation aléatoire d'objet. Voici leurs noms:

BG_DEB_B1
BG_DEB_B2
BG_DEB_B3

et voici le scripte que j'ai essayé sans succés:

//Creation de l'index du sprite
IDSPRITE=random(3)

//Creation du nom de la variable portant la racine du nom + index
BG_DEB_B_NAME=string(BG_DEB_B)+string(IDSPRITE)

//Creation de l'instance
instance_create(230+random(500),-200,BG_DEB_NAME)

..j'imagine que c'est une broutille que vous n'aurez aucun mal à résoudre vous les vrais! ..merci beaucoup!
Revenir en haut Aller en bas
Invité
Invité




Variable en string.. :-) Empty
MessageSujet: Re: Variable en string.. :-)   Variable en string.. :-) EmptyVen 15 Juin 2007 - 12:29

Salut! Smile

Essaye ceci :

Code:
execute_string("instance_create(230+random(500),-200,BG_DEB_B"+string(ceil(random(3))))

Si besoin est, je peux expliquer un peu, mais il est préférable que tu apprennes par toi-même. clinoeuil
Revenir en haut Aller en bas
Invité
Invité




Variable en string.. :-) Empty
MessageSujet: Re: Variable en string.. :-)   Variable en string.. :-) EmptyVen 15 Juin 2007 - 15:21

Je pense qu'Oane tu n'es vraiment pas mauvais si tu commence à toucher à la programmation car tout le monde ne trouverait pas cette solution Wink
Le code que t'a fourni Bep est bon, je signale au passage qu'il existe une fonction choose(argument0,argument1,...)
qui choisit au hasard un des arguments entre parenthèse (mais ya un maximum autorisé)
Avec tu pourrais faire instance_create(x,y,choose(obj1,obj2,obj3))
Revenir en haut Aller en bas
Wargamer
*Excellent utilisateur*
Wargamer


Messages : 6938
Projet Actuel : Bataille de cake au fruits

Variable en string.. :-) Empty
MessageSujet: Re: Variable en string.. :-)   Variable en string.. :-) EmptyVen 15 Juin 2007 - 17:13

ca serais plus simple avec
if floor(random(3))=1 {ennemie1}
if floor(random(3))=1 {ennemie2}
if floor(random(3))=1 {ennemie3}
si ca marche :nah:

_________________
Variable en string.. :-) Wargamer3
Règle #1 du CBNA, ne pas chercher à faire dans la subtilité; personne comprend
Revenir en haut Aller en bas
Oane
Utilisateur moyen
Oane


Messages : 60
Localisation : Paris

Variable en string.. :-) Empty
MessageSujet: Re: Variable en string.. :-)   Variable en string.. :-) EmptyVen 15 Juin 2007 - 22:09

Merci les gars ça marche au poil !!! .. j'ai opté pour le choose qui me semblait moins casse geule au niveau de la syntaxe pour un mec comme moi mais je garde la syntaxe de bep17 sous le coude, je sens que ça me sera utile un jour ou l'autre!
Encore merci!
super super super
Revenir en haut Aller en bas
Contenu sponsorisé





Variable en string.. :-) Empty
MessageSujet: Re: Variable en string.. :-)   Variable en string.. :-) Empty

Revenir en haut Aller en bas
 
Variable en string.. :-)
Revenir en haut 
Page 1 sur 1
 Sujets similaires
-
» Obtenir le nom d'une variable grâce à un string
» Draw_Text_Color avec un string et un variable ne marche pas
» [String] nombre de Lettres affiché < que string
» [résolu] Une variable globale ou une variable locale persistante?
» variable dans le nom d'une variable

Permission de ce forum:Vous ne pouvez pas répondre aux sujets dans ce forum
Forum Le CBNA :: Développement :: Entraide débutants-
Sauter vers: